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Beach Acronychia | Broad-margined Mining Bee |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om | Plantae (Plants)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Magnoliophyta (Flowering Plants) | Arthropoda (Arthropods) |
| Class | Magnoliopsida (Dicots) | Insecta (Insects) |
| Order | Sapindales (Sapindales) | Hymenoptera (Ants, Bees & Wasps) |
| Family | Rutaceae | Andrenidae |
| Genus | Acronychia | Andrena |
| Species | Acronychia imperforata | Andrena synadelpha |
